1. Learn to have tons of fun.

When you are having fun it flows to everyone around you. When someone is having a great time, they tend to draw attention to their area. Just smile and relax.

2. Don’t give everything away.

When you tell a good joke the punch line is always at the end. Although you can give a snippet of what makes you stand out, but be cautious not to tell the whole story of your life on the first couple of pages. Leave something to be discovered. 3. Be yourself.

If you are being yourself that will help you get recognized. Try to get away from the crowd some of time. For example, when you get your drink from the bartender slowly make your way back to your group of friends. Groups are much more intimidating to approach than a single person.

4. Meet him eye to eye.

This might seem like a simple tip but it works really well. A simple short look from across the room can do wonders.

5. Show swagger.

Making your movement noticible is what swagger is all about. Don’t fret, there is no strict definition for it, just be you and show your style. Your swagger should be unique to you. Your body language should reflect who you are. Your movements should give off some positive energy that lets him know that you are open for conversation. A loving hug will show compassion. If you’re daring, sharp movements will show you take risks.
